California's varied climate, ranging from arid desert regions to temperate coastal zones, directly influences wildlife activity and the methodologies required for effective control. Seasonal shifts, such as the dry summer months that concentrate animals around water sources, or the wet winters that can drive rodents and other pests into structures seeking shelter, necessitate adaptive strategies. The state's extensive urban development encroaching upon natural habitats further exacerbates human-wildlife conflicts, demanding precise intervention techniques. How do I get rid of animals in my yard in California?

Addressing unwanted animals in your yard typically involves identifying the species and their attractants. For California residents, this may include securing refuse bins to deter raccoons or sealing entry points to prevent opossums from seeking harborage. What is the 3-3-3 rule for rehoming dogs?

The 3-3-3 rule is a guideline for integrating new dogs into a home, representing the typical adjustment periods: three days for feeling overwhelmed, three weeks for learning routines, and three months for feeling at home. What are the permitting quirks for wildlife control in California?

California has specific regulations governing wildlife management, often involving permits for trapping and relocation of certain species, particularly those protected under state or federal law. The Department of Fish and Wildlife oversees these requirements.
